Alexander Graham Bell, (born March 3, 1847, Edinburgh, Scotland—died August 2, 1922, Beinn Bhreagh, Cape Breton Island, Nova Scotia, Canada), Scottish-born American inventor, scientist, and teacher of the deaf whose foremost accomplishments were the invention of the telephone (1876) and the refinement of the phonograph (1886).. ALEXANDER GRAHAM BELL was born March 3, 1847, in Edinburgh, Scotland, the second son of Alexander Melville Bell (born 1819—died 1905), an eminent phonetician and lecturer on elocution and inventor of &quot;Visible Speech&quot; symbols, and Eliza Grace (Symonds) Bell (born 1809— died 1897), a daughter of Dr. Samuel Symonds, surgeon in the British Royal Navy.
